August 2014

[Review] ติดโฆษณาบน Android App ของเรา ด้วย Vserv.mobi : Part 2 การเขียนคำสั่ง

จากความเดิมตอนที่แล้ว [Review] ติดโฆษณาบน Android App ของเรา ด้วย Vserv.mobi : Part 1 เตรียมความพร้อม เราก็พร้อมที่จะเขียน Code เพื่อแสดงโฆษณาของ Vserv.mobi ใน Android App ของเราแล้ว ใครที่ยังไม่ได้อ่านบทความใน Part 1 ไปอ่านให้จบก่อนนะคร๊าบบบบบ….

[Review] ติดโฆษณาบน Android App ของเรา ด้วย Vserv.mobi : Part 1 เตรียมความพร้อม

นอกจาก AdMob จาก Google แล้ว Vserv.mobi คือผู้ให้บริการโฆษณาอีกรายหนึ่ง ที่มี SDK หลากหลาย Platform ให้นักพัฒนา App นำไปใช้เพื่อติดโฆษณาสำหรับหารายได้ สำหรับบน Android นั้น ทาง Vserv.mobi ได้เตรียมรูปแบบโฆษณาให้เราไว้ 2 รูปแบบ นั่นคือ Banner และ Billboard (หรือที่เรียกกันว่า Interstitial หรือ Full Screen) นั่นเอง […]

[Dev] วิธีอ่านชื่อ Property, Method, Class และ Namespace บน Visual Basic.NET

ไปเขียนบทความฝั่ง Android ซะเยอะ วันนี้มาฝั่ง Visual Basic.NET กันบ้างละกันเน๊อะ บทความนี้เกิดขึ้นมาจากความสงสัยของผม ว่า… ถ้าอยากเขียนคำสั่ง เพื่ออ่านชื่อ Property ใน Visual Basic.NET เพื่อนำไปใช้งานต่อ เช่น Print Log ออกมาดู จะต้องเขียนคำสั่งอย่างไร ตัวอย่างเช่น Class Form จะมี Property FormBorderStyle อยู่ แล้วจะเขียนคำสั่งอย่างไร ให้ได้ออกมาเป็น String […]

[Gallery] Nexus Fusion in Thailand

กาลครั้งหนึ่ง เมื่อนานมาแล้ว มีเหล่าผู้ใช้ Nexus ในประเทศไทย จาก Nexus Club Thailand @ facebook ได้รวมตัวกัน ในงาน Android Workshop 2014 ที่ทาง GDG Thailand จัดขึ้น เมื่อวันที่ 31 พฤษภาคม 2557 ซึ่งก่อนถึงวันงาน ผม ได้คุยกับ Ake Exorcist ว่า […]

[Dev] Custom WebView บน Android

เนื่องจากว่า ใน App Ethan’s Web Reader ที่ใช้สำหรับอ่านบทความจากเว็บนี้แหล่ะ มีส่วนที่แสดงด้วย WebView อยู่ด้วย ซึ่งผมต้องการทราบ Position ที่ WebView นั้นแสดงอยู่ แบบ Real time แต่ก็พบว่า ไม่มี Listener ตัวไหน ที่จะให้ตรวจสอบแบบ Real time ได้เลย สำหรับบทความตอนนี้ ผมจะทำการ Custom WebView […]

[Dev] หลากหลายรูปแบบ กับการเขียนคำสั่ง Listener บน Android

บทความตอนนี้ ขอพูดถึงเรื่องง่าย ๆ บ้าง เพื่อให้มือใหม่ได้เรียนรู้พื้นฐานของการพัฒนา App บน Android เชื่อว่าหลายคนที่เป็นมือใหม่ ได้อ่าน ได้ดู Code จากหลาย ๆ ตำรา แล้วพบว่า การจัดการกับเหตุการณ์ (Event) ต่าง ๆ ที่ User กระทำนั้น เราจะต้องทำการ Implement ส่วนที่เรียกว่า Listener ซึ่งรูปแบบการเขียนนั้น มีหลากหลายวิธี บางวิธีก็ไม่ค่อยน่าใช้งาน […]

[Dev] Callback โทรกลับหน่อยนะ (บน Java)

หลังจากที่ได้เขียนบทความแนะนำเรื่อง Callback บน JavaScript และ Callback บน VB.NET ไป เมื่อไม่นานมานี้ (แค่ปีกว่า ๆ เอง) คราวนี้ของคราวของ Java บ้าง (ใครยังไม่เข้าใจว่า Callback คืออะไร อ่านตอนที่แล้วก่อนนะครับ) เนื่องจาก Java นั้น ไม่มี Delegate เหมือนของ VB.NET และไม่สามารถส่งชื่อ Function เข้าไปได้เหมือนของ […]

[Dev] Activity Lifecycle พื้นฐาน Android ที่ Developer ควรรู้

หลังจากที่ได้ฝึกเขียน App บน Android มาเกือบ 2 ปี ด้วยการอ่านตำราบ้าง ดูตามเว็บบ้าง อ่าน Reference จากเว็บ Android Developer บ้าง StackOverflow.com บ้าง ถามชาวบ้านเอาบ้าง และมั่วเอาบ้าง แต่ไม่เคยได้ปรับพื้นฐานที่ควรจะแม่นก่อน ซึ่งเป็นสิ่งสำคัญมาก และเป็นพื้นฐานมาก ๆ ของการพัฒนา App บน Android นั่นก็คือ Activity Lifecycle […]